Why Abram?

  • Now the Lord had said unto Abram, Get thee out of thy country, and from thy kindred, and from thy father’s house, unto a land that I will shew thee:

  •  This is our introduction to Abram,  it is the same invitation we received to know the Lord.

  • The Lord had said;
  • How many times has the Lord called out to us before we finally get our act together?
  • Get out of there:
  • We must repent, turn away from our old ways and embrace the Way of the Lord.
  • To a land I will show you;
  • The Lord has made a plan and place just for us, if we will allow Him to bring us there.

I believe that the Lord introduced us to Enoch,  Noah and Abram so we could see the potential for our own lives.   These men were incredibly special,   distinct from the rest of the world in their life times.   Not because the Lord called out to them.

 

They were special and different and distinct from the rest of the world because they were obedient to what the Lord was speaking to them.

 

They were not any different then we are.   They just purposed in their hearts to seek the Lord,  to walk in His ways.  To live their lives to honor and obey the Lord.     Abram believed in the Lord and the Lord counted it for righteousness.

 

Enoch, Noah and Abram all believed and acted on their beliefs,  that is why the Lord used them.  The Lord will also use us as we accept the measure of faith available to us.
